Mrs. Oma Dell Troutt, age 85, Bethpage, TN., passed away December 31, 2007.
Funeral services were held Thursday, January 3, 2008, at 11:00 A.M. from the chapel of Woodard Funeral Home.
Bro. Clayton Hall and Bro. Ray Lauffenburger officiated. Interment was in Forest Chapel Cemetery.
Pallbearers were Travis Bush, Jeremy Troutt, Brandon Troutt, Brady Troutt, Nigel Dillard and Bubba Wilson, honorary pallbearers were Harold Akens and Eaton Crawford.
She was the daughter of the late George Carter and Emma Sullivan Carter. She was retired from the Eaton Corp. and was a member of Providence General Baptist Church. She was also preceded in death by a son, Michael R. Troutt, four brothers, Harry, Paul Jr., Barney and George "Mutt" Carter and a sister, Rosie Ferguson. She is survived by her husband, Homer Ray Troutt of Bethpage, two daughters, Mona Langford, Gallatin, Sue Dillard, Portland, two sons, David Troutt and Jeff Troutt both of Bethpage, brother, James Carter and sister, Katie Lowery both of Gallatin.
Woodard Funeral Home, Westmoreland, in charge of arrangements.
